One of the advantages to copper clad aluminum conductors is that they weigh much less than copper conductors. They are lighter than solid copper wires, so they're easier to handle and install. This may include, but is not limited to, a reduction of labor cost and/or support structures. Meanwhile, the copper clad aluminum conductors remain high quality. Copper coated for superior electrical conductivity and resistance to wear with a hard, aluminium core for strength and durability. This enables electricity to be transmitted with a low level of power loss. Thus, the copper and aluminum combination in such conductors provide an economical as well as reliable solution for a wide variety of electrical applications.

Applications typically used for copper clad aluminum conductors are power distribution, telecommunication and automotive. They are used in overhead lines, underground cables and substations. Due to their good conductivity and light weight, they are well suited to transport electricity over long distances with limited energy losses. In telecommunication, they are employed as conductors of both data and voice transmission signals. It provides optimal conductivity to transmit signal, the Aluminum core is durable while the outer PVC jacket provides flexibility. In automobile applications, such conductors are employed in wiring harnesses and battery cables. Light weight of them decrease the total weight of vehicle and enhance endurance in fuel.
